About This Event

Historic Fort Snelling provides guided Juneteenth tours teaching visitors about the fort's Black history, Black communities in Minnesota, and the Black people and groups who occupied the fort, including Dred and Harriet Scott and the 25th Infantry. The event runs June 19, 10 a.m.–4 p.m., with cost included in site admission.
